DIXIE CLIPPER MAKES RECORD FLIGHT
(Received February 9, 7.30 p.m.) MIAMI, February 8. Pan-American Airways announced that the Dixie Clipper, with Mr Wendell Willkie aboard, landed at Port of Spain at 9.51 a.m., thus completing the 3120 miles non-stop flight from Bolam in 21 hours 32 minutes. This is the longest non-stop flight ever made by a commercial plane.
